--- Comment #7 from Jan Beich (mail not working) <jbeich at FreeBSD.org> ---
Maybe start contributing upstream. No one is paid to support Firefox on
FreeBSD. In fact, the build is busted at least twice per week as there's no CI
in place (Solaris RIP). Many features available on Tier1 platforms are simply
not implemented: Sandbox, GeckoProfiler, CrashReporter, network link state
detection, GamePad API, EME, PPAPI. OSS audio is one of those. I've tried to
help but no luck - the contributor ran away. The patch is now a source of
rebase churn and maybe dropped in future.

Or make PulseAudio suck less on FreeBSD, or implement missing features in
sndio, or triage user stories into actionable bugs. Words are cheap, of course.
